Bounced Email Testing

This example sends an email to bounce@chilkatsoft.com. Chilkat has setup a mailbox (bounce@chilkatsoft.com) that has a message limit of 2. The mailbox is already full, so any messages sent to it will generate an automated mailbox-full bounce reply. Chilkat is providing this mailbox so you may test your bounce handling programs.

'  The mailman object is used for sending and receiving email.
Dim mailman As New Chilkat.MailMan()

'  Any string argument automatically begins the 30-day trial.
Dim success As Boolean
success = mailman.UnlockComponent("30-day trial")
If (success <> true) Then
    MsgBox("Component unlock failed")
    Exit Sub
End If


'  Set the SMTP server.
mailman.SmtpHost = "smtp.chilkatsoft.com"
mailman.SmtpUsername = "myUsername"
mailman.SmtpPassword = "myPassword"

'  Create a new email object
Dim email As New Chilkat.Email()

email.Subject = "This is a test"
email.Body = "This is a test"
email.From = "Chilkat Support <support@chilkatsoft.com>"

'  You may test by sending email to bounce@chilkatsoft.com.
'  Chilkat created this email acccount explicitly for testing.
'  Any email sent to it will receive a "mailbox-full" bounce reply.
email.AddTo("Chilkat Bounce Testing","bounce@chilkatsoft.com")

'  Bounced email will be delivered to this address:
email.BounceAddress = "bounce.processor@chilkatsoft.com"

'  Note: the BounceAddress property equates to setting the
'  "return-path" email header.  Mail bounces are sent
'  to the email address specified in the "return-path" header
'  field, which may be different than the email address in
'  the "From" header field.

success = mailman.SendEmail(email)
If (success <> true) Then
    MsgBox(mailman.LastErrorText)
Else
    MsgBox("Mail Sent!")
End If
